The Science Behind Vitamin E Absorption
Vitamin E is a fat-soluble nutrient, meaning it requires dietary fat for effective absorption by the body. In the small intestine, it is incorporated into mixed micelles—tiny structures made of bile salts and products of fat digestion. These micelles transport the vitamin across the intestinal wall. Once inside the cells, vitamin E is packaged into chylomicrons, which are then released into the lymphatic system before entering the bloodstream. A specialized protein in the liver then helps distribute alpha-tocopherol to tissues.
The Critical Role of Dietary Fat
Consuming vitamin E with a meal containing dietary fat is the single most important factor for maximizing absorption. Studies indicate that as little as 3-18 grams of fat can significantly enhance uptake. The type of fat might also play a role. For supplements, taking them with a fat-containing meal is crucial.
Comparing Natural vs. Synthetic Vitamin E
Natural RRR-alpha-tocopherol (d-alpha-tocopherol), found in foods, is more bioavailable than the synthetic all-rac-alpha-tocopherol (dl-alpha-tocopherol) often in supplements. While supplements and fortified foods can help meet needs, whole foods offer additional nutrients that support absorption and overall health.
The Importance of Whole Food Sources
Many vitamin E-rich foods like nuts, seeds, and avocados already contain the necessary fats for absorption. Studies show that adding fat-containing foods like eggs to vegetables can increase tocopherol absorption from the vegetables.
Avoiding Factors that Impair Absorption
Some factors can hinder absorption, including excessive polyunsaturated fatty acids and, in large amounts, plant sterols and fiber. Individuals with fat malabsorption conditions should seek medical advice.
Comparison of Vitamin E Sources
| Source | Key Characteristics | Bioavailability | Best For |
|---|---|---|---|
| Whole Foods (nuts, seeds, oils, greens) | Natural RRR-α-tocopherol, healthy fats, complementary nutrients. | High | Daily intake, balanced nutrition. |
| Natural Supplements (d-α-tocopherol) | Concentrated RRR-α-tocopherol. Requires fat. | Good (less than food) | Filling gaps, higher doses. |
| Synthetic Supplements (dl-α-tocopherol) | Lower bioavailability. | Lower (about half of natural) | Less expensive option. |
| Fortified Foods (cereals, juices) | Added synthetic vitamin E. | Moderate (depends on food/fat) | Supplementing intake. |
Strategic Pairing with Complementary Nutrients
Pairing vitamin E with vitamin C may help regenerate vitamin E and enhance its antioxidant activity. Phospholipids, found in foods like eggs, may also increase vitamin E bioavailability. Nanoformulations might offer enhanced absorption in the future.
